Viatcheslav  Nazarov

Memorial page

This page is a tribute to my friend and effort to preserve the memory of Viatcheslav  Nazarov, Russian musician who died in a car accident on January 2, 1996 near Denver, Colorado. He left us forever at age of  43. Hundreds of his friends in Russia, USA and other countries cannot forget this great man ever met him. Thousand of jazzmen all over the former Soviet Union and listeners in jazz festivals in Paris, Bombay, Prague, Helsinki loved his performance. 

We are still in the process of collecting records of Slava's performance
in audio and video, his pictures and reminiscence about this extraordinary jazzman. It is called Viatcheslav  Nazarov memorial project. We have shot retrospective interviews in New York, Moscow and Ufa (Russia) and even Bangkok, Thailand. Some private persons
and organizations support us with raw video footage and musical records of Viatcheslav  Nazarov.
